RTX makes equipment for airplanes and the military. Pratt & Whitney, one of its units, builds aircraft engines. Collins Aerospace, another unit, makes aircraft systems such as EPACS, which manages power and heat on a plane. RTX also makes weapons for the US military, including the Patriot missile system for air defense and the Javelin missile. The company is based in Arlington, Virginia.
RTX formed in 2020, when Raytheon and United Technologies merged. Raytheon itself dated back to 1922. RTX stock trades on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ker RTX and is part of the S&P 500 index. In 2025 the company had 180,000 employees and made $88.6 billion in revenue, making it one of the largest employers in aerospace and defense.
